I'm in Hawaii and currently use the following setup to pick up 119 and 110:

24" dish pointed at 119
30" dish pointed at 110

2 SW21 feeding an 811 and a 501

I picked up a satellite finder on Ebay and tried to find the 129 sat to see if I can receive it here.

After pointing in the general direction I was receiving a signal on the finder. When I went inside to check my receivers it shows the following for 129 and my zip code (96740) under peak angles:

811 receivers shows129 but doesn't give any angle info (P333)
501 receiver does not even show the 129 sat (P304 software)

Do I need to do anything to make the receivers pick up 129 or should it just be there?

I'm hoping to get a lease deal on a 942 and want to make sure I can receive 129 before doing so.

I don't think ANY receiver is programmed with angle data for 129 yet.

If you're getting a green bar, you're good to go.

As for the 501, note that it will NOT pick up any of the HD transponders, sp you've got to scan around - but there's nothing on 129 for it anyway.
 
Dune, you know that adding a third sat. location and using legacy equipment you will need a SW64 switch. 129 is a lot less powerful of a satellite than 110 and 119 so you will definetely need at least a 30" (76cm) to 40" (1.0m) dish if I had to guess.
